Airing from 1988 to 1991, China Beach followed nurse Colleen McMurphy (Dana Delany) as she lived and worked at an evacuation hospital and USO entertainment center at the titular beach on the South China Sea during the warand as she romanced pilot Natch Austen (Tim Ryan) and pined for Dr. Dick Richard (Robert Picardo). Bill Kilgore, popularized the catchphrase, Charlie dont surf. Kilgore utters the famous line while angrily answering a soldier who questions Kilgores plan to take a patch of Viet Cong territory specifically because its a good spot for surfing. China Beach is an American dramatic television series set at an evacuation hospital during the Vietnam War.The title refers to My Khe beach in the city of Nng, Vietnam, nicknamed "China Beach" in English by American and Australian soldiers during the Vietnam War.
